Utah Regulations
Comprehensive guide to seller financing laws, usury limits, and disclosure requirements in Utah.
Maximum Interest Rate
None
Business exemptions may apply
Usury Laws
Interest rate limits and penalties
Maximum Rate
No Limit
Penalty Type
No specific penalty
Notes
Utah has no usury statute. Rate determined by contract.
Business Exemption
Utah has no general usury limit.
Seller Financing Requirements
Disclosures, licensing, and restrictions
Required Disclosures
- Seller's Property Condition Disclosure
- Lead-based paint disclosure (pre-1978)
Licensing Required
No license required
No license required for seller financing own property.
Consumer Protection
Applicable laws protecting buyers
- Utah Consumer Sales Practices Act
Real Estate Specifics
Foreclosure process and property laws
- Deed of Trust state
- Non-judicial power of sale foreclosure
- No statutory redemption after sale
